The Dow Jones industrial average briefly turned negative on Wednesday, while the S&P 500 pared gains as shares of major pharmaceutical companies weighed.

The Nasdaq traded near break-even as the semiconductor and drug groups dragged.

The Dow Jones industrial average <.DJI> was up 2.27 points, or 0.02 percent, at 10,408.25. The Standard & Poor's 500 Index <.SPX> was up 1.83 points, or 0.16 percent, at 1,120.14. The Nasdaq Composite Index <.IXIC> was up 2.18 points, or 0.10 percent, at 2,282.97.
